Enabling timing analysis in the presence of caches has been pursued by the real-Time embedded systems (RTES) community for years due to cache's huge potential to reduce software's worst-case execution time (WCET). However, caches heavily complicate timing analysis due to hard-To-predict access patterns, with few works dealing with time analyzability of multi-level cache hierarchies. For measurement-based timing analysis (MBTA) techniques-widely used in domains such as avionics, automotive, and rail-we propose several cache hierarchies amenable to MBTA. We focus on a probabilistic variant of MBTA (or MBPTA) that requires caches with time-randomized behavior whose execution time variability can be captured in the measurements taken during sys...
Embedded systems are becoming ubiquitous in our daily life. Due to close interaction with physical w...
Cache memories have a huge impact on software's worst-case execution time (WCET). While enabling the...
Cache memories are one of the hardware resources with higher potential to reduce worst-case executio...
Enabling timing analysis in the presence of caches has been pursued by the real-Time embedded system...
Caches are key resources in high-end processor architectures to increase performance. In fact, most ...
The use of caches challenges measurement-based timing analysis (MBTA) in critical embedded systems. ...
Cache memories are one of the hardware resources with higher potential to reduce worst-case executio...
© 2013 IEEE. The increasing performance demand in the critical real-time embedded systems (CRTES) do...
Timing is a key non-functional property in embedded real-Time systems (ERTS). ERTS increasingly requ...
In critical domains, the advent of high-performance (complex) hardware, used to provide the rising l...
Time Randomised caches (TRc), which can be implemented at hardware level or with software means on c...
The use of caches challenges measurement-based timing analysis (MBTA) in critical embedded systems. ...
Obtaining Worst-Case Execution Time (WCET) estimates is a required step in real-time embedded system...
Caches provide significant performance improvements, though their use in real-time industry is low b...
Real-time systems are witnessing a significant increase in critical software's size, complexity, and...
Embedded systems are becoming ubiquitous in our daily life. Due to close interaction with physical w...
Cache memories have a huge impact on software's worst-case execution time (WCET). While enabling the...
Cache memories are one of the hardware resources with higher potential to reduce worst-case executio...
Enabling timing analysis in the presence of caches has been pursued by the real-Time embedded system...
Caches are key resources in high-end processor architectures to increase performance. In fact, most ...
The use of caches challenges measurement-based timing analysis (MBTA) in critical embedded systems. ...
Cache memories are one of the hardware resources with higher potential to reduce worst-case executio...
© 2013 IEEE. The increasing performance demand in the critical real-time embedded systems (CRTES) do...
Timing is a key non-functional property in embedded real-Time systems (ERTS). ERTS increasingly requ...
In critical domains, the advent of high-performance (complex) hardware, used to provide the rising l...
Time Randomised caches (TRc), which can be implemented at hardware level or with software means on c...
The use of caches challenges measurement-based timing analysis (MBTA) in critical embedded systems. ...
Obtaining Worst-Case Execution Time (WCET) estimates is a required step in real-time embedded system...
Caches provide significant performance improvements, though their use in real-time industry is low b...
Real-time systems are witnessing a significant increase in critical software's size, complexity, and...
Embedded systems are becoming ubiquitous in our daily life. Due to close interaction with physical w...
Cache memories have a huge impact on software's worst-case execution time (WCET). While enabling the...
Cache memories are one of the hardware resources with higher potential to reduce worst-case executio...